People's Leasing presents van to hospital

People's Leasing and Finance PLC (PLC) recently donated a van to the cancer unit of the Karapitiya Teaching Hospital, Galle (home based palliative care unit).


People's Leasing and Finance CEO and General Manager D. P. Kumarage hands over the keys of the vehicle to cancer specialist Dr. Upul Ekanayake.

People's Leasing Head Office IT division and the PLC Galle branch engaged in this worthy cause.

The vehicle worth Rs. 3.5 million was donated to further strengthen the home based palliative care services carried out by the hospital for the betterment of cancer patients in acute condition who were treated and sent back to their homes.

Chief cancer specialist Dr. Upul Ekanayake said, "Cancer patients who are beyond cure need special assistance. The patients need nursing care and assistance to keep their moral high. We have a dedicated task-force comprising doctors, nurses and assistants."

"They pay home visits to check the health of patients and provide them with whatever such patients need and this donation will add muscle and value to the process," he said.

He said that earlier the home based palliative unit could visit only one patient a month and now these visits can be increased to ten by deploying the van donated by PLC.

People's Leasing also donated branded mugs and food packets to around 225 resident-patients and branded umbrellas to over 140 officials, doctors, nurses and staff of the palliative care unit.
